Fires of Purity

(Spell Compendium, p. 94)

Evocation [Fire]
Level: Druid 6, Sorcerer 6, Wizard 6, Shugenja 6 (Fire), Purification (SpC) 6,
Components: V, S, DF,
Casting Time: 1 standard action
Range: Touch
Target: Creature touched
Duration: 1 round/level
Saving Throw: See text
Spell Resistance: Yes (harmless); see text

You touch the target, and it bursts into flames that do not harm it, although the heat you feel from the fire seems quite real to you.

The creature you touch bursts into magical flames that do not harm the subject, but are capable of harming anyone else who comes into contact with the creature.

With a successful melee attack, the subject deals an extra 1 point of fire damage per caster level (maximum +15). If the defender has spell resistance, it applies to this effect. Creatures that make successful melee attacks against the subject are susceptible to the same damage unless they attack with weapons that have reach, such as longspears.

The subject of fires of purity takes only half damage from fire-based attacks. If such an attack allows a Reflex save for half damage, the subject takes no damage on a successful save.
